METHOD FOR CULTIVATION OF INTERMEDIATE SOY VARIETIES WITH THERMAL CONDITIONS 2201-2300°C FOR GRAIN, MAINLY IN DROP IRRIGATION SYSTEM Russian patent published in 2009 - IPC A01B79/02 

Abstract RU 2354091 C1

FIELD: agriculture.

SUBSTANCE: method envisages stubble ploughing of a forecrop, soil processing with herbicide, application of fertilizers, real tillage, prevernal breaking up of soil and levelling. Thereafter, preplanting irrigation and cultivation at a depth of 4-5 cm, soil compaction before and after seeding, planting are carried out. When sprouts are appeared, harrowing and irrigation are carried out within vegetation period. Microelements - molybdenum, boron, cobalt, manganese, zinc, copper are applied at the rate 75-95, 25-35, 40-75, 20-95, 25-35, 20-30 g/hectare respectively, together with irrigation water within the phase of "tillering-blooming". Iodine and nickel are applied at the rate 20-40 and 50-80 g/hectare together with the before mentioned microelements on the phase of "blooming - bean formation", vanadium at the ratio 30-40 g/hectare and titanium at the rate 20-25 g/hectare are applied separately in a wetting within the phase "bean formation - bean filling". Microelements - beryllium and chrome are applied at the ratio 18-37 and 26-45 g/hectare in the phase "bean filling - beginning of grain ripeness". Barium and strontium are applied at the dosage of 17-28 and 13.6-26.5 g/hectare together with irrigation water within the phase "beginning of grain ripeness - complete ripeness". Desiccation and crop harvesting are carried out after complete ripeness of grain.

EFFECT: increase in productivity and of oil content in soy seeds.
